在信息爆炸的时代,如何高效地学习和成长成为了一个关键问题。深度学习法作为一种新兴的学习方法,正逐渐受到人们的关注。本文将深入探讨深度学习法的原理、实践方法以及如何运用它来提升个人的学习效率。

深度学习法的原理

1. 什么是深度学习?

深度学习是机器学习的一个子领域,它模仿人脑的神经网络结构,通过多层非线性变换来学习数据中的复杂模式。与传统的机器学习方法相比,深度学习能够在没有人工特征工程的情况下,自动从原始数据中提取特征。

2. 深度学习的工作原理

深度学习模型通常由多个层级组成,每个层级负责提取不同层次的特征。这个过程类似于人类大脑的认知过程,从感官输入到高级抽象思维。

深度学习法的实践方法

1. 数据准备

在进行深度学习之前,首先需要准备高质量的数据集。数据集的质量直接影响模型的性能。

import pandas as pd

# 假设有一个CSV文件,包含用户的学习数据
data = pd.read_csv('learning_data.csv')

# 数据预处理,如清洗、归一化等
# ...

2. 模型选择

选择合适的模型对于深度学习至关重要。根据不同的任务,可以选择不同的神经网络架构,如卷积神经网络(CNN)用于图像识别,循环神经网络(RNN)用于序列数据。

from keras.models import Sequential
from keras.layers import Dense, Conv2D, Flatten

# 构建一个简单的CNN模型
model = Sequential()
model.add(Conv2D(32, (3, 3), activation='relu', input_shape=(64, 64, 3)))
model.add(Flatten())
model.add(Dense(10, activation='softmax'))

3. 训练与优化

模型的训练是深度学习过程中的关键步骤。需要选择合适的损失函数和优化器,并通过调整超参数来优化模型性能。

model.compile(optimizer='adam', loss='categorical_crossentropy', metrics=['accuracy'])

# 训练模型
model.fit(x_train, y_train, epochs=10, batch_size=32)

如何运用深度学习法提升个人成长

1. 自我认知

通过深度学习方法,可以分析自己的学习习惯、兴趣点和知识结构,从而更好地规划学习路径。

2. 知识整合

深度学习可以帮助我们理解不同知识领域之间的联系,促进知识的整合和创新。

3. 终身学习

深度学习强调不断学习和适应新知识,这有助于我们在快速变化的世界中保持竞争力。

总结

深度学习法为个人成长提供了一种全新的视角和方法。通过理解和运用深度学习,我们可以更高效地学习、工作和生活。在未来的日子里,深度学习将继续发挥其重要作用,引领我们走向更加智能化的未来。